Unlocking the Power of Thymosin Alpha‑1 for Immune Health
Thymosin Alpha‑1, a small peptide naturally present in the thymus gland, plays a key role in immune regulation. It helps strengthen immune response, supports recovery, and may even enhance vaccine response. Because it actively boosts T‑cell activity, many researchers consider it a foundational agent in immune therapies.
How Thymosin Alpha‑1 Supports the Immune System
First, Thymosin Alpha‑1 elevates the activity of T-lymphocytes—the body’s frontline defenders. Furthermore, it stimulates the maturation of dendritic cells and promotes cytokine production that balances immune response. These effects together support a robust, targeted reaction to infections and allergens.
Moreover, research indicates that Thymosin Alpha‑1 may mitigate immune dysfunction linked to chronic viral infections, including hepatitis B and C. For example, studies have shown it can reduce viral load and improve liver enzyme markers. Potential Benefits Beyond Immunity
Beyond immune modulation, Thymosin Alpha‑1 is increasingly studied for its anti-inflammatory and regenerative properties. In clinical settings, patients receiving it alongside chemotherapy reported improved quality of life and enhanced wound healing. Transitioning into mental health, emerging data hints at its ability to reduce stress-related inflammation, although more trials are needed.

Safety Profile & Side Effects
Thymosin Alpha‑1 is generally well tolerated. Mild side effects—such as injection site irritation, headache, or fatigue—were reported in under 10% of cases. Serious reactions are rare. However, people with autoimmune disorders or those receiving immunosuppressive therapies should use caution. Scientific Research & Ongoing Studies
Recent trials explore Thymosin Alpha‑1’s role in managing COVID‑19, melanoma, and chronic fatigue syndrome. Early findings suggest immune enhancement and improved symptoms, but large-scale randomized studies are underway.
